I'm just thinking that there should be some sort of wire that could hold EU and Redstone current at the same time.
Like it could be low voltage and Redstone conductive. It could be crafted by
the recipe would also yield 6 wires.
There could also be refined iron poles that you could slide down faster than ladders
And if you have a powered magnetiser and metal boots equipped you could slide up faster than ladders. crafting:

The recipe would also yield 4poles
I don't know if I just described a ironfence but they never seem to work